Immigrants from Asia vs Iranian Vision Disability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 547,864,164 people shows a moderate neg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Asia and percentage of population with vision dis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.442 and weighted average of 1.9%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 316,677,046 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Iranians and percentage of population with vision dis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.248 and weighted average of 1.8%, a difference of 7.2%.
